Stictosiphonia kelanensis (Grunow ex E.Post) R.J.King & Puttock 1989
Publication Details
Stictosiphonia kelanensis (Grunow ex E.Post) R.J.King & Puttock 1989: 48, figs 2b, 18b, 19a
Published in: King, R.J. & Puttock, C.F. (1989). Morphology and taxonomy of Bostrychia and Stictosiphonia (Rhodomelaceae / Rhodophyta). Australian Systematic Botany 2: 1-73, 25 figs, 4 tables.
Type Species
The type species (holotype) of the genus Stictosiphonia is Stictosiphonia hookeri (Harvey) Harvey.
Status of Name
This name is currently regarded as a synonym of Bostrychia kelanensis Grunow ex Post.
Basionym
Bostrychia kelanensis Grunow ex Post
Type Information
Type locality: "Hab. in littore maris prope Kelana Novæ Guineæ" [Kelanoa, Papua New Guinea]; (Post 1936: 21) Type: L. Kärnbach 40; viii.1888; in littore maris; W; Notes: "Holotype, not found" [Necchi & Vis 2022: 81).
General Environment
This is a marine species.
